Staples Says “Thanks a Million” in Celebration of Teacher Appreciation Week
April 27 2016 - 11:42AM
Business Wire
Company to Provide One Million Thank You Cards
for Customers to Honor Teachers;
Donates More Than $425,000 in 3D Printers to
Schools and Universities Nationwide
To celebrate teachers and all they do, Staples, Inc. (NASDAQ:
SPLS) is giving customers the opportunity to thank a teacher that
has made a difference in their lives by providing one million free
thank you cards in Staples’ stores across the country or
Staples.com/giftcards during Teacher Appreciation Week, May
2-6.

Staples Makes More than $425,000 3D
Printer DonationAs part of Teacher’s Appreciation Week,
Staples Business Advantage, the business-to-business division of
Staples, will celebrate innovation in classrooms and donate more
than $425,000 worth of MakerBot 3D printers and accessories to
select schools and universities across the United States. The
donations will include Replicator and Replicator Mini 3D printers,
3D digital scanners, and 3D filaments in various colors. Staples
Business Advantage will work closely with the schools to integrate
these printers into the STEM (science, technology, engineering and
mathematics) curriculum to provide students access to 3D printing
technologies.
“These printers offer students and teachers an opportunity to
turn their creative ideas into a reality by applying thought design
and engineering skills to a hands-on learning experience,” said
Marty Robertson, vice president, technology solutions, Staples
Business Advantage. “This donation seeks to foster knowledge of 3D
printing, which is a rapidly developing segment of design and
manufacturing.”
In addition, as part of the Staples 3D printer donation,
MakerBot will provide a range of resources to help educators
integrate 3D printing in the classroom including the MakerBot in
the Classroom handbook with ideas and activities to get started
with 3D printing.
A few of the schools and universities receiving the printers
include: Alliance College-Ready Public Schools in Los Angeles,
California, Wayne County Schools in Goldsboro, North Carolina, and
Dallas Independent School District in Dallas, Texas.
